And he put all things under his feet and gave him as head over all things to the church, which is his body, the fullness of him who fills all in all.
Ephesians 1:22-23 ESV

Because of His Son's obedience --- His sinless blameless life --- God the Father exalted Jesus, put all things under His feet and made Him head of the church, which is His body.

The church's purpose is to display His fullness to all the world. Bring light where there is darkness. Bring order where there is chaos. Bring love and compassion where there is hurt-full hate. Bring truth where there is deception and confusion. Bring wholeness to places of corruption. Bring life to those who are dying. Bring purity to places and people who have been defiled. Bring justice to those who are oppressed. Bring freedom to those who are captive. Bring hope and good news to those in despair. Bring healing to those suffering dis-ease.

Do you see the church fulfilling that role?

Paul gave thanks for the Ephesian church. For their faith in the Lord Jesus and their love toward one another in the church. But he also remembered them in his prayers, asking God to grow them even more and more into the fullness of Christ Jesus.
